Concrete foundation repair services focus on addressing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ically involve assessing the condition of the existing foundation, identifying areas of damage or deterioration, and implementing appropriate solutions to restore stability. Common repair methods may include underpinning, slab jacking, crack repair, or the installation of piers and supports to reinforce the foundation. The goal is to ensure the foundation remains secure and capable of supporting the weight of the structure above.

Problems that concrete foundation repair services aim to resolve often stem from shifting, settling, or cracking of the foundation. These issues can lead to uneven floors, sticking doors and windows, or visible cracks in walls and the foundation itself. If left unaddressed, foundation problems may cause further structural damage, compromise safety, or result in costly repairs. Repair services are designed to stabilize the foundation, prevent further movement, and mitigate the risk of additional damage to the property.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Prairie Village, KS.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range - The typical cost for concrete foundation repair varies widely, generally falling between $2,500 and $7,000. For example, minor cracks may cost around $1,000, while extensive foundation work can exceed $10,000.

Factors Affecting Cost - Expenses depend on the extent of damage, foundation size, and repair method. A small crack repair might be priced at approximately $500 to $1,500, whereas major underpinning could reach $15,000 or more.

Average Prices - On average, homeowners in Prairie Village, KS, can expect to pay between $3,000 and $8,000 for foundation repair services. Costs can increase if additional structural work or moisture mitigation is required.

Cost Variability - Costs vary based on local labor rates, foundation type, and severity of issues. Repairing a concrete foundation typically ranges from about $2,000 to over $12,000, depending on the project sc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window or door frames.

How long does concrete fo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but many repairs can be completed within a few days to a week.

Are there different types of foundation repair methods? Yes, options include underpinning, mudjacking, piering, and crack injection, selected based on the specific issue and foundation type.

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require repair, but it is advisable to have a professional assess whether they indicate underlying issues.
